Wexford Science & Technology and its development partner Ventas, Inc. (NYSE: VTR) today announced a significant investment into 3711 Market Street, one of Philadelphia’s leading multi-tenant life sciences facilities located within the uCity Square Knowledge Community. The 10-story, 150,000 square foot building has long served as a launchpad for some of the city’s most prominent life science companies and their advances in biotech and medicine.

The project, scheduled to be completed in 2025, will update the building’s common areas and lab infrastructure while maintaining its crucial role in supporting the growth of current tenants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E: LLY), Spark Therapeutics, Inc., and Good Molecules.

The $28.5 million investment will include:

  • A renovated building lobby offering contemporary furnishings and a range of seating types designed to facilitate meeting, working, and collaborating among tenants and partners.
  • Increased HVAC and back-up power capacity, ensuring the building can meet the evolving demands of today’s complex R&D environments.
  • Move-in ready lab and office suites tailored to accommodate a wide range of company needs.
  • Capital for future leasing buildouts.
